Laundry Services

The Correction Enterprises Laundry Industry is a large and complex operation.

Six laundries meet the cleaning needs of the state prisons, as well as several hospitals and state agencies. The laundries process over 25 million pounds of laundry annually.

Prior to 1957, the North Carolina Department of Correction operated a Laundry System which only satisfied the needs of the Department. In 1957, an expansion program began which encompassed not only all of the Department’s needs, but also took care of several county Hospital’s needs.With the expansion, Correction Enterprises successfully negotiated contracts to supply the management and labor for several in-house facilities. Currently the laundry supplies service for over 22,000 beds throughout the State and processing over 28 million pounds of laundry annually.

What is the Umstead Act ?

Legislature Statute    G.S. 66-58(a).

In general, the Umstead Act (the “Act”) prohibits North Carolina government agencies from competing with the private commercial activities of North Carolina citizens. NC State University and its employees must comply with the Act. The Act specifically prohibits North Carolina government agencies from: Rendering services to the public that are ordinarily provided by private businesses

There are currently six laundries that meet the cleaning needs of the state prisons, as well as several hospitals and state agencies. The laundries are located at Craggy Correction (Asheville, North Carolina), Broughton Hospital (Morgantown, NC), Umstead Hospital (Butner, NC), Central Prison (Raleigh, NC), Cherry Hospital (located in Goldsboro, NC known as Chase), and Sampson Correctional (Clinton, NC).

Craggy Laundry

Asheville, NC

Founded in 1962 on the grounds of the Old Craggy Correctional Facility, Craggy Laundry handles an average of 3.5 million pounds of laundry per year. The 12,400 square foot facility employs a staff of 8 to manage over 55 inmate workers.

Broughton Laundry

Morgantown, NC

Broughton Laundry is located on the historical campus of Broughton Hospital in Morganton, North Carolina. Broughton Laundry process an average of 3.4 million pounds of laundry per year. The 17,000 square foot facility employs a staff of 9 to manage over 50 inmate workers.

Umstead Laundry

Butner, NC

Located on the Historical grounds of the Old John Umstead Hospital Campus, Umstead Laundry handles an average of 2.95 million pounds of laundry per year. The 17,000 square foot facility employs a staff of 8 to manage over 45 inmate workers.

Central Prison Laundry

Raleigh, NC

Founded in 1957, the laundry at Central Prison handles an average of 500 thousand pounds of laundry per year. The 600 square foot facility employs a staff of 2 to manage 10 inmate workers.

Chase Laundry

Goldsboro, NC

Transferred from DHHS to DPS in 2001, Chase Laundry is located on the historical grounds of the old Cherry Hospital grounds Goldsboro, North Carolina Chase Laundry was built in 1978 and named after Nancy Chase who was a Legislator, Humanitarian, Civic Leader and Farmer. The 43,000 square feet facility employs 16 employees and 85 inmate worker producing over 5.5 million pounds of linen annually.

Sampson Laundry

Clinton, NC

Founded in 1971, Sampson Laundry handles an average of 10 million pounds of laundry per year. The 50,000 square foot facility employs a staff of 28 to manage over 200 inmate workers with a second Shift.

The Correction Enterprises employ its own in house Maintenance Department, the laundries operate and maintain a fleet of over 28 tractors, 35 trailers, 11 three ton van trucks and 10 one ton trucks. Combined these vehicles travel 1 million miles (annually) across North Carolina for pick-ups and deliveries.
